Thanks > > [AndersW] First of all, keep in mind that the "headless" state > should ideally not last a very long time. Once we have the spare > SC feature in place (ticket [#79]), a new SC should become active > within a matter of a few seconds after we have lost both the > active and the standby SC. > > I think you should view the state of the cluster in the headless > state in the same way as you view the state of the cluster during > a failover between the active and the standby SC. Imagine that the > active SC dies. It takes the standby SC 1.5 seconds to detect the > failure of the active SC (this is due to the TIPC timeout). If you > have configured the PROMOTE_ACTIVE_TIMER, there is an additional > delay before the standby takes over as active. What is the state > of the cluster during the time after the active SC failed and > before the standby takes over? > > The state of the cluster while it is headless is very similar. The > difference is that this state may last a little bit longer (though > not more than a few seconds, until one of the spare SCs becomes > active). Another difference is that we may have lost some state. > With a "perfect" implementation of the headless feature we should > not lose any state at all, but with the current set of patches we > do lose state. > > So specifically if we talk about cluster membership and ask the > question: is a particular PL a member of the cluster or not during > the headless state? Well, if you ask CLM about this during the > headless state, then you will not know - because CLM doesn't > provide any service during the headless state. If you keep > retrying you query to CLM, you will eventually get an answer - but > you will not get this answer until there is an active SC again and > we have exited the headless state. When viewed in this way, the > answer to the question about a node's membership is undefined > during the headless state, since CLM will not provide you with any > answer until there is an active SC. > > However, if you asked CLM about the node's cluster membership > status before the cluster went headless, you probably saved a > cached copy of the cluster membership state. Maybe you also > installed a CLM track callback and intend to update this cached > copy every time the cluster membership status changes. The > question then is: can you continue using this cached copy of the > cluster membership state during the headless state? The answer is > YES: since CLM doesn't provide any service during the headless > state, it also means that the cluster membership view cannot > change during this time. Nodes can of course reboot or die, but > CLM will not notice and hence the cluster view will not be > updated. You can argue that this is bad because the cluster view > doesn't reflect reality, but notice that this will always be the > case. We can never propagate information instantaneously, and > detection of node failures will take 1.5 seconds due to the TIPC > timeout. You can never be sure that a node is alive at this very > moment just because CLM tells you that it is a member of the > cluster. If both SCs goes down, > checkpoint replicas on > surviving nodes > > still > > remain. When a SC is available > again, surviving replicas are > > automatically > > registered to the SC checkpoint > database. Content in > surviving > > replicas are > > intacted and synchronized to new > replicas. > > When no SC is available, client API > calls changing checkpoint > > configuration > > which requires SC communication, are > rejected. Client API > calls > > reading and > > writing existing checkpoint replicas > still work. > > Limitation: The CKPT service does > not support recovering > checkpoints > > in > > following cases: > - The checkpoint which is unlinked > before headless. > - The non-collocated checkpoint has > active replica locating > on SC. > - The non-collocated checkpoint has > active replica locating > on a PL > > and this > > PL restarts during headless state. > In this cases, the > checkpoint > > replica is > > destroyed. The fault code > SA_AIS_ERR_BAD_HANDLE is returned > when the > > client > > accesses the checkpoint in these > cases. The client must > re-open the > checkpoint. > > While in headless state, accessing > checkpoint replicas does > not work > > if the > > node which hosts the active replica > goes down. It will back > working > > when a > > SC available again. > > Solution: > --------- The solution for this > enhancement includes 2 parts: > > 1. To destroy un-recoverable > checkpoint described above when > both > > SCs are > > down: When both SCs are down, the > CPND deletes un-recoverable > > checkpoint > > nodes and replicas on PLs. Then it > requests CPA to destroy > > corresponding > > checkpoint node by using new message > CPA_EVT_ND2A_CKPT_DESTROY > > 2. To update CPD with checkpoint > information When an active > SC is up > > after > > headless, CPND will update CPD with > checkpoint information by > using > > new > > message > CPD_EVT_ND2D_CKPT_INFO_UPDATE instead of > using > CPD_EVT_ND2D_CKPT_CREATE. This is > because the CPND will > create new > > ckpt_id > > for the checkpoint which might be > different with the current > ckpt id > > if the > > CPD_EVT_ND2D_CKPT_CREATE is used. The CPD > collects checkpoint > > information > > within 6s. During this updating > time, following requests is > rejected > > with > > fault code SA_AIS_ERR_TRY_AGAIN: > - CPD_EVT_ND2D_CKPT_CREATE > - CPD_EVT_ND2D_CKPT_UNLINK > - CPD_EVT_ND2D_ACTIVE_SET > - CPD_EVT_ND2D_CKPT_RDSET > > > Complete diffstat: > ------------------ > osaf/libs/agents/saf/cpa/cpa_proc.c > | 52 > > +++++++++++++++++++++++++++++++++++ > > osaf/libs/common/cpsv/cpsv_edu.c | 43 > > +++++++++++++++++++++++++++++ > > osaf/libs/common/cpsv/include/cpd_cb.h > | 3 ++ > > osaf/libs/common/cpsv/include/cpd_imm.h > | 1 + > > osaf/libs/common/cpsv/include/cpd_proc.h > | 7 ++++ > > osaf/libs/common/cpsv/include/cpd_tmr.h > | 3 +- > > osaf/libs/common/cpsv/include/cpnd_cb.h > | 1 + > > osaf/libs/common/cpsv/include/cpnd_init.h > | 2 + > > osaf/libs/common/cpsv/include/cpsv_evt.h > | 20 +++++++++++++ > > osaf/services/saf/cpsv/cpd/Makefile.am > | 3 +- > osaf/services/saf/cpsv/cpd/cpd_evt.c > | 229 > > > ++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++ > > > > ++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++ > > > ++++ > > osaf/services/saf/cpsv/cpd/cpd_imm.c | 112 > > > ++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++ > > > > osaf/services/saf/cpsv/cpd/cpd_init.c | > 20 ++++++++++++- > > osaf/services/saf/cpsv/cpd/cpd_proc.c | 309 > > > ++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++ > > > > ++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++ > > > > +++++++++++++++++++++++++++++++++++++++++++++++++++++++++++ > > > osaf/services/saf/cpsv/cpd/cpd_tmr.c | > 7 ++++ > > osaf/services/saf/cpsv/cpnd/cpnd_db.c | > 16 ++++++++++ > > osaf/services/saf/cpsv/cpnd/cpnd_evt.c | > 22 +++++++++++++++ > > osaf/services/saf/cpsv/cpnd/cpnd_init.c > | 23 ++++++++++++++- > > osaf/services/saf/cpsv/cpnd/cpnd_mds.c | > 13 ++++++++ > > osaf/services/saf/cpsv/cpnd/cpnd_proc.c | > 314 > > > ++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++ > > > > ++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++ > > > > +++++++++++++++++++++++++++++++++++++++++++++++++++++++++++--- > > > 20 files changed, 1189 > insertions(+), 11 deletions(-) > > > Testing Commands: > ----------------- > - > > Testing, Expected Results: > -------------------------- > - > > > Conditions of Submission: > ------------------------- > <<HOW MANY DAYS BEFORE PUSHING, > CONSENSUS ETC>> > > > Arch Built Started Linux distro > ------------------------------------------- > mips n n > mips64 n n > x86 n n > x86_64 n n > powerpc n n > powerpc64 n n > > > Reviewer Checklist: > ------------------- > [Submitters: make sure that your review > doesn't trigger any > checkmarks!] > > > Your checkin has not passed review because > (see checked entries): > > ___ Your RR template is generally > incomplete; it has too many > blank > > entries > > that need proper data filled in. > > ___ You have failed to nominate the proper > persons for review and > push. > > ___ Your patches do not have proper > short+long header > > ___ You have grammar/spelling in your > header that is unacceptable. > > ___ You have exceeded a sensible line > length in your > > headers/comments/text. > > ___ You have failed to put in a proper > Trac Ticket # into your > commits. > > ___ You have incorrectly put/left internal > data in your comments/files > (i.e. internal bug tracking tool > IDs, product names etc) > > ___ You have not given any evidence of > testing beyond basic build > tests. > Demonstrate some level of runtime > or other sanity testing. > > ___ You have ^M present in some of your > files.
